Tridimensional rotational flow sieve trays (TRST) have a variety of gas–liquid flow structures, such as rotational flow, flow through one perforation and flow through two perforations, it is important to have a deep understanding of the coupling and distribution laws of rotational flow and flow through perforations for the selection and regulation of actual working conditions. In this study, the flow structures and proportions for the rotational–perforated coupling flow in a TRST were analyzed and predicted using the measured distribution ratio for the three-blade unit. The results showed that the gas phase mainly flowed in a rotational pattern, and its proportion was approximately 62%–83%. The proportion of flow through perforations in the liquid phase was relatively large, and the proportion of flow through one perforation was approximately 51%–57%. The proportion of flow through two perforations was approximately 27%–29%.

Using CFD simulation, we first investigated the flow field distribution of the tridimensional rotational flow sieve tray (TRST) under different structural parameters (i.e. number of the blades, twist angle of the blades, tray height and sieve hole diameter) and installation methods (forward and backward) when gas flows downward through the TRST. Secondly, we carried out a comparative study of three modified structures of the tray, i.e. no supporting ring, a closed internal cylinder and no sieve holes present. Finally, we studied the transformed situations of the rotational flow and propose a dimensionless correlation to evaluate the performance of the tray. The results show that, apart from the tray with a smaller twist angle of the blade, the gas flow field distributions for all the other types of trays are similar. When two trays are installed, the gas flow field of the second tray in a forward installation is obviously different to that of a backward installation. The transformed position of the rotational flow for most types of trays is about half the depth of the tray. After comprehensive evaluation, the optimized tray structures are identified as a configuration with 8 blades, a 90° twist angle of the blades, a tray height of 40 mm, and sieve holes of 5 mm diameter. In addition, the tray should have open internal cylinder without a supporting ring. When a multi-tray is installed, the backward installation method should be adopted.

Quality cementation of a borehole heat exchanger is often considered to be important parameter when analysing long-term heat pump efficiency. Implementing low conductivity grout leads to an increase of borehole thermal resistance and poor heat transfer. This paper analyses one real retrofit project which comprises of 16 borehole heat exchangers with thermal enhanced grout completion. Novel approach of testing the borehole heat exchanger was implemented, so called Steady-State Thermal Response Step Testing, which incorporate series of power steps to determine borehole capacity at steady-state heat transfer conditions and thermogeological properties of ground. Paper objective was to quantify what is real benefit by implementing more expensive thermal enhanced grout, compared to traditional bentonite, silica-sand grouts. Simulation of borehole temperatures and coefficient of performance (COP) changes over time was carried out with Ground Loop
(GLD), taking into account four different grout mixes.
shown that in thermogeological environment with mediocre thermal conductivity, distinction in COP was modest for each of the four analysed grouting material during 30 years. Comparing investment costs with savings in electricity for each grout mix case, conclusion is that there is no real benefit of implementing enhanced grout in mediocre thermal conductivity environment such as marly-clays.

The article presents observations from recent architectural historical research on the post-war construction of Slovene coastal towns. The urban planning concepts that formed the "Slovenian Coast" ...and followed the migration processes are explored. The solutions for the Slovenian Coast are compared with contemporary urban plans for Trieste, set in a larger historical framework. Certain interventions in "ethnically pure" locations (new settlements called 'borghi' on the Karst boundary surrounding Trieste; new construction in the Venetian core of Capodistria) are highlighted, and approaches in the design of new urban areas and two symbolic spaces of representations on both sides of the border are compared.
